Impact

The amendment proposed in AB 1935 may have minimal direct impact on the existing regulatory framework, as it does not introduce new requirements or alter the foundational principles established by the Cemetery and Funeral Act. Instead, it focuses on refining the application process for licensure. This could potentially enhance the efficiency of obtaining a cemetery broker license, making it easier for applicants while maintaining the overall structure of regulation that ensures professional standards in the field of cemetery and funeral services.

Summary

Assembly Bill No. 1935, introduced by Assembly Member Johnson, seeks to amend Section 7651 of the Business and Professions Code, which pertains to the licensure and regulation of cemetery brokers under the Cemetery and Funeral Act. The existing law mandates that applications for cemetery broker licenses must be submitted in writing using a prescribed form and filed at the principal office of the Cemetery and Funeral Bureau. AB 1935 aims to streamline this process by making a nonsubstantive change to the current application requirements, although specific details on these changes are not provided in the bill text.
